What is it ? 


When we worked on process template, it quickly became obvious that we needed a way to make the templates dynamic

Variables available

  • Process name, purpose text
  • Process owner
  • Diagram title, breadcrumbs
  • Version control information


How to use


variables are in double brackets {{ your variable }}

The list of variable can be found in the app, in the "help" menu at the top right corner.
